That isn't the same Steelers team that we're used to seeing. What's up?
Some bad drafting, some bad luck and injuries, and age is catching up with them. As Kontra said they are going to have to undergo the same kind of rebuild the Patriots have engaged in the past 4 years. They do have some good building blocks in DeCastro and Pouncey, as well as Heyward who played lights out yesterday, but they are going to have to really maximize their drafts the next few years and make good decisions with their own free agents and those available in free agency. As difficult as it would have been for them to swallow they probably should have unloaded some of their vets at the trade deadline, and they really should have taken that 3rd from NE for Sanders. If they can get anything for guys like Keisel, Clark, Taylor in the coming offseason they should take it and use the extra picks to help them rebuild. However in their condition they are going to have to do as good a job with undrafted free agents as the Patriots have to get back to contender status in the near future. Pare it down to the core they want to rebuild around, cut the excess salary and pick up as many picks as they can wherever they can. It's always been a really well run organization so they can get back to contender status but they are going to have to make some really tough decisions and many really good ones to get there.
